Ultralow Noise and Spurious 0.35GHz to 6GHz Integer-N Synthesizer

Part Details

  • Low Noise Integer-N PLL
  • 350MHz to 6GHz VCO Input Range
  • –226dBc/Hz Normalized In-Band Phase Noise Floor
  • –274dBc/Hz Normalized In-Band 1/f Noise
  • –157dBc/Hz Wideband Output Phase Noise Floor
  • Excellent Spurious Performance
  • Output Divider (1 to 6, 50% Duty Cycle)
  • Low Noise Reference Buffer
  • Output Buffer Muting
  • Charge Pump Supply from 3.15V to 5.25V
  • Charge Pump Current from 250μA to 11.2mA
  • Configurable Status Output
  • SPI Compatible Serial Port Control
  • PLLWizard Software Design Tool Support

PLLWizard

PLLWizard is used to communicate with the LTC6945 and LTC6946 synthesizers. It uses the DC590 controller to translate between USB and SPI-compatible serial communications formats. It also includes advanced PLL design and simulation capabilities which aid in loop filter design and selecting the correct SPI map register values.

DC2429A

LT3042 Low Noise PLL/VCO Power Supply Board with Onboard 100MHz Reference Frequency

Product Details

Demonstration Circuit 2429A is a PLL/VCO Supply and Reference Frequency Board that features the LT3042, an ultralow noise and ultrahigh PSRR RF linear regulator. When powered from a 6V to 20V lab or wall wart supply, the DC2429A produces four ultralow noise supplies using seven LT3042s. These supplies include a fixed 3.3V/800mA supply (four LT3042's in parallel), a fixed 5V/200mA supply, a fixed 3.3V/200mA supply that powers an onboard 100MHz ultralow jitter crystal oscillator, and an adjustable voltage (2.5V to 15V), 200mA supply ideal for powering external VCOs. The DC2429 ensures PLL/VCO evaluation meets data sheet performance.
